I am usually not fan of crop tops. I find them kiddy and showing my abs is usually not my style, even if they were dead fit. But I found a way around with this top because I really like it. The easiest way to style crop tops with no outerwear and show as little abs as possible is to style it with a high-waisted skirt or trousers. Which is exactly what I did here.
